Frequently Asked Questions

How do Johnson C Smith University and Carlow University compare?
Johnson C Smith University (Charlotte, NC) has an acceptance rate of 45.2%, in-state tuition of $21,300, and median 10-year earnings of $42,680. Carlow University (Pittsburgh, PA) has an acceptance rate of 87.0%, in-state tuition of $35,874, and median 10-year earnings of $51,051.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, Johnson C Smith University or Carlow University?
Carlow University gra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$51,051 vs $42,680.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, Johnson C Smith University or Carlow University?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), Carlow University is the more affordable option at $20,786 per year versus $20,894.
Which school has a better 4-year graduation rate?
Carlow University has the higher 4-year graduation rate: 57.6% vs 34.2%.
